# tan-ids
`tan-ids` is a simple utility for validating and identifying Tanzanian identification numbers, including National ID (NIDA), Voter ID (KURA), Driver's License (LESENI), Passport (PASIPOTI), and Zanzibar Resident ID (ZAN ID).

### List of Supported ID Types
The package includes the following Tanzanian ID types:
| Name | Code | Example Format |
|-------------------------------------|--------|----------------------|
| Kitambulisho cha Taifa (National ID) | NIDA | 12345678-12345-12345-12 |
| Kitambulisho cha Mpiga Kura (Voter ID) | KURA | T1234-5678-901-2 |
| Leseni ya Udereva (Driver's License) | LESENI | 1234567890 |
| Hati ya Kusafiria (Passport) | PASIPOTI | AB123456 |
| Kitambulisho cha Mkazi wa Zanzibar | ZAN ID | 123456789 |
## API
### `matchIdType(idNumber: string): ID_TYPE | null`
- Takes an ID number as input (string) and returns the corresponding ID type if valid, otherwise returns `null`.
- The function automatically removes spaces and dashes before matching.
### `ID_TYPES`
- An array of ID type objects, each containing:
- `name`: The full name of the ID type.
- `code`: A short code representing the ID type.
- `pattern`: A regex pattern for validation.
- `readable_pattern`: A human-readable format pattern.
